Provider
Ruby Fortune: online casino, licence from Kahnawake (Canada), without an Austrian licence under the Gambling Act.
According to our research, the contracting party of Ruby Fortune is Baytree Interactive Ltd (registration number 69691, registered in Guernsey), based on the ground floor of Kingsway House, Havilland Street, St Peter Port, Guernsey. The platform holds a licence from the Kahnawake Gaming Commission (number 00892 (issued 16 February 2022)). The parent company is the Palace Group.
The operator and licence are identical to River Belle (both Palace Group / Baytree Interactive). The MGA licence MGA/B2C/145/2007 is recorded as ‘Surrendered’. The brand has been active since 2003 and remains in operation.
Online casino offerings directed at Austrian players require a licence in Austria. Without this licence under the Gambling Act, the underlying contract is void. According to the settled case law of the Austrian Supreme Court (OGH), losses can be reclaimed retroactively for up to thirty years.
